Hl2 was made to run from top to bottom of mainstream video cards, scaling all the way back to the TnT2 from nvidia.
Unfortunutly there are a handfull of video cards, and integrated graphics sets which there 3d is laughable. Via / S3 chipsets are the main culprits and there are more bad sis chipsets than good ones in existance. Most of them would strugle up against early generation offerings from nvidia / 3dfx.
and we're on what, 9th generation of nvidia hardware now, (Riva128, TnT, TnT2, Geforce 1-4, Fx, 6).
Technically there was an nvidia before the riva128 aka the nv1, but it was erm paperweight like.
The good news is you should have a fully fledged agp 8x slot on your board, so expansion to somthing more potent should be a snap.
I just had a giggle looking up the via site for info on the chip thats on your board. All they give is that it has an integrated unichrome 2d/3d graphics core. Thats it, no speed, number of pipelines or even technology level
